In a recent episode of his podcast, Logan Paul expressed his strong conviction that the WWE’s legendary founder, Vince McMahon, will be inducted into the WWE Hall of Fame in the near future. Paul’s comments have sparked widespread speculation within the wrestling community, with many fans eagerly anticipating the possibility of Vince’s return.
